There is nothing quite like the comforting aroma that fills the home when baking with family. Inspired by late nights in the kitchen with Mom, Goose Island employee Paul Spiller sought to capture that sweet moment in this year’s newest member of the Bourbon County Brand Stout family.

2024 Bourbon County Brand Macaroon Stout is an imperial stout aged for a full year in bourbon barrels before adding rich cocoa nibs, sweet candied ginger and toasted coconut. This decadent stout is an homage to the flavors of homemade coconut macaroons with a twist of nostalgia.

2024 bottle from Total Wine. Pours a pitch black with a finger of beige head that lingers. Huge dark chocolate, milk chocolate and coconut focused aromas with bourbon, oak and vanilla as it warms. Bourbon throughout with some fig, dark chocolate, coconut, chocolate drizzle and oak throughout. Same notes on the palate that lingers. Balanced finish with warming bourbon barrel, oak and chocolate. Excellent!

On tap at The Beer Temple, pours black with a small light brown head. Aroma smells like a macaroon, with candied ginger and coconut upfront, followed by dark sugars, bourbon, and some cocoa. Flavour is rich, with lots of decadent coconut upfront, somewhat masked by the ginger, and sort of complemented by the cocoa. Finishes very buttery. The bourbon rounds things out nicely. Unusual blend of ginger and coconut, which I don�t think I�ve experienced before. It�s certainly very well-made, but far from my favourite BCBS variant.
